00:00Ellen DeGeneres pulls her $30 million U.K. farmhouse off the market, amid reports she wants to move back to U.S.
00:09Ellen DeGeneres and her wife Portia de Rossi reportedly had their farmhouse in the U.K. taken off the market.
00:17According to a Realtor.com report published on Thursday, January 22, the former talk show host's $30 million listing for the Cotswolds property is no longer available.
00:28The outlet noted that the couple listed the house in July, and it is unclear whether they secured a buyer.
00:35The Comedian, 67, and the Ally McBeal alum, 52, initially purchased the property in June 2024 for $18 million.
00:44But when they decided to move to the U.K. full-time, they bought a different estate to accommodate de Rossi's horses.
00:51A source told the National Enquirer last month that DeGeneres and de Rossi are looking to move their lives back to the U.S.
01:00It got them away from Trump's America and provided Ellen a refuge to carefully plot her comeback without the noise and pressure that she had back in Los Angeles.
01:09The source explained of the couple's move to England, before noting that now, the day-to-day reality of life in the rainy countryside has gotten increasingly boring and frustrating for both of them.
01:21Both of them are in agreement that it's time to head back, the source added.
